Olivier Ntcham goal gives Celtic victory over Partick Thistle

Olivier Ntcham scored the only goal of the game as Celtic beat Partick Thistle at Firhill.

The champions have won both of their opening Scottish Premiership games and sit atop the table before the weekend’s action.

James Forrest could have given Celtic the lead within the opening 10 minutes but his shot was well saved by Tomas Cerny.

Celtic did lead midway through the first half when a clearance from a corner fell to Ntcham who volleyed into the net from the edge of the area.

Scott Brown nearly doubled the lead before half time but his header went over the bar.

Celtic’s dominance continued in the second half and Kieran Tierney had a chance in the 50th minute. He intercepted Christie Elliott’s pass but shot wide.

Thistle could have grabbed an equaliser a minute later. Elliott’s cross found the head of Kris Doolan but the striker could not hit the target from six yards.

Callum Booth then came to the rescue to stop Jozo Simunovic’s header on the line before Tom Rogic’s shot hit the side-netting.

It looked like Celtic would blow their lead in stoppage time but Thistle’s penalty appeal was turned down. Most fans thought that Nir Bitton fouled Miles Storey but referee Andrew Dallas’ opinion was the only one that mattered and he waved play on.

Celtic have now extended their unbeaten domestic run to 51 matches.
